What is Copper Foil?

Copper foil is a thin sheet of pure copper, typically produced through either electrodeposition (electroforming) or rolling processes. Electrodeposited (ED) copper foil is created by depositing copper ions from a solution onto a rotating mandrel, forming a thin, uniform layer. This method allows for precise control over thickness and surface properties, making it ideal for electronics applications. Rolled Annealed (RA) copper foil is made by mechanically rolling thicker copper sheets into thin foils. RA foil is generally softer, more ductile, and has better elongation properties than ED foil, making it suitable for applications requiring flexibility and resistance to cracking.

The properties of copper foil – its excellent electrical and thermal conductivity, malleability, ductility, and corrosion resistance – make it indispensable in a wide array of industries. The thickness of copper foil is measured in ounces per square foot (oz/ft²) or micrometers (µm). Common thicknesses for electronic applications range from 0.5 oz/ft² (approx. 17.5 µm) to 2 oz/ft² (approx. 70 µm), with thicker foils used in power applications or cable manufacturing. Surface texture also plays a role; foils can have smooth or textured surfaces, influencing adhesion and performance in specific applications.

Manufacturing Processes: ED vs. Rolled Foil

The two primary methods for producing copper foil dictate its characteristics and suitability for different applications. Electrodeposited (ED) foil is created through electrolysis. Copper ions in an acidic solution are deposited onto a cathode (mandrel). The foil’s properties, such as thickness, tensile strength, and surface roughness (both on the drum side and the ion-stream side), can be finely controlled by adjusting parameters like current density, temperature, and additives in the plating bath. ED foils are generally preferred for high-frequency PCBs and applications requiring precise thickness control. Rolled Annealed (RA) foil is produced by repeatedly passing copper through rolling mills, thinning the metal incrementally. This process imparts a more uniform grain structure, resulting in a softer, more flexible foil that is less prone to fracturing under stress. RA foil is often used in applications where flexibility is key, such as flexible PCBs, wire wrapping, or certain types of batteries.

Types of Copper Foil Available

When looking to buy copper foil in India Telangana, buyers will encounter several types, each suited for specific applications:

  • Electrodeposited (ED) Copper Foil: Available in various thicknesses (e.g., 1 oz, 0.5 oz) and surface treatments (e.g., standard, low-profile, high-adhesion). Preferred for high-frequency PCBs and applications requiring precise thickness.
  • Rolled Annealed (RA) Copper Foil: Known for its softness and ductility. Used in flexible circuits, high-temperature applications, and where high elongation is needed.
  • High-Purity Copper Foil: Essential for demanding applications like advanced batteries, high-performance PCBs, and specialized shielding, offering superior conductivity and reduced impurity levels.
  • Tinned Copper Foil: Copper foil coated with a thin layer of tin. This enhances solderability and corrosion resistance, often used in specific electronic connectors and shielding applications.

The choice depends heavily on the end-use requirements, including electrical conductivity, flexibility, operating temperature, and environmental resistance.

How to Choose the Right Copper Foil for Your Needs

Selecting the appropriate copper foil is critical for the performance, reliability, and cost-effectiveness of your end product. Several factors must be considered to ensure you are buying the right type and specification of copper foil in India Telangana.

Key Factors to Consider:

  1. Application Requirements: Clearly define the intended use. Is it for rigid PCBs, flexible PCBs, battery electrodes, EMI shielding, heat sinks, or decorative purposes? Each application has specific material demands.
  2. Electrical Conductivity: For electronic applications, high conductivity is paramount. Ensure the foil meets the required conductivity standards (often expressed as %IACS – International Annealed Copper Standard). High-purity copper foils offer the best conductivity.
  3. Thickness and Weight: Specify the required thickness, usually in micrometers (µm) or ounces per square foot (oz/ft²). This impacts current carrying capacity, flexibility, and cost.
  4. Surface Properties: Consider whether a smooth (drum side) or rough (ion-stream side) surface is needed. Rougher surfaces offer better adhesion to substrates like polyimide or FR-4. Special treatments (e.g., low-profile, high-adhesion) further enhance performance.
  5. Mechanical Properties: Evaluate the need for ductility, tensile strength, and elongation. RA foils are better for applications requiring bending or flexing, while ED foils offer greater dimensional stability.
  6. Environmental Resistance: Consider the operating environment. Will the foil be exposed to high temperatures, humidity, or corrosive elements?
  7. Supplier Reliability and Quality Assurance: Choose suppliers who can provide consistent quality, adherence to specifications, and proper certifications. Work with established manufacturers or distributors in Telangana or reputable national suppliers.
  8. Cost: Balance the technical requirements with your budget. While high-performance foils may be more expensive, they might be necessary for critical applications.

Cost and Pricing Factors for Copper Foil in India Telangana

The cost of copper foil is influenced by several dynamic factors, making it essential for buyers in India Telangana to understand these elements to secure competitive pricing and manage their procurement budgets effectively for 2026.

Primary Cost Drivers:

  • Copper Market Price: The global price of copper is the most significant factor. Fluctuations in LME (London Metal Exchange) copper prices directly impact the cost of copper foil.
  • Manufacturing Process: Electrodeposited foil typically has different cost structures than rolled annealed foil, influenced by energy consumption, chemical inputs, and equipment complexity.
  • Foil Specifications: Key specifications directly affect price:
    • Thickness: Thinner foils (e.g., 0.5 oz) are generally more expensive per unit area than thicker ones (e.g., 2 oz) due to the precision and material handling involved.
    • Purity: High-purity copper (e.g., 99.9% or higher) commands a premium over standard commercial grades.
    • Surface Treatment: Specialized surface treatments or finishes can add to the cost.
    • Width and Length: Custom widths or specific roll lengths may incur additional processing charges.
  • Order Volume: Larger order quantities typically result in lower per-unit costs due to economies of scale in production and logistics.
  • Supplier and Location: Pricing can vary between manufacturers and distributors. Sourcing locally within Telangana might offer logistical cost savings compared to suppliers in other regions or imported materials.
  • Market Demand: High demand, particularly from rapidly growing sectors like electronics and EVs, can influence pricing.

What is the difference between ED and RA copper foil?

Electrodeposited (ED) copper foil is formed electrolytically, offering precise thickness control and varied surface textures, ideal for PCBs. Rolled Annealed (RA) copper foil is mechanically produced, making it softer, more ductile, and suitable for flexible applications.

How is copper foil thickness measured?

Copper foil thickness is commonly measured in ounces per square foot (oz/ft²) or micrometers (µm). For reference, 1 oz/ft² is approximately 35 µm. Specific applications dictate the required thickness for optimal performance.
